AFSCME Employees Benefits Summary
Leave Benefits
Vacation
Vacation accruals are as follows, with no waiting period for use of accruals:
| Months of Continuous Service | Semi-monthly Accrual Rate (hours) | Equivalent Annual (hours) | Maximum Accrual (hours) 2x Annual |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 through 48 months | 4.0 | 96 | 192 |
| 49 through 96 months | 5.0 | 120 | 240 |
| 97 through 144 months | 5.5 | 132 | 264 |
| 145 through 168 months | 5.75 | 138 | 276 |
| 169 through 228 months | 6.0 | 144 | 288 |
| 229 months and over | 6.25 | 150 | 300 |
Sick Leave
Employees receive 4.0 hours of sick leave each semi-monthly pay period, with a maximum accrual of 1,000 hours. Accruals are available for use as they’re earned.
Sick Leave Incentive Program
Upon PERS retirement, a proration of unused sick leave may be rolled into employee’s VEBA account (see VEBA benefit below).
Paid Holidays
Employees receive 10 paid holidays each calendar year. Click here for a listing of City-observed holidays.
Floating Holiday Leave
Employees are frontloaded 24 hours of floating holiday leave in January of each year (leave is pro-rated for new hires). This leave can be taken in place of vacation or other accrued leave but must be used by the end of each calendar year. Unused leave does not roll over and is not subject to payout.
Bereavement Leave
Bereavement Leave up to 5 days with pay per death occurrence for covered family member(s). May be supplemented by use of other applicable leave accruals.
Insurance
Medical, Dental & Vision
Full medical, dental, and vision coverage for employee and all eligible dependents with City paying approximately 95% of premium. The current employee contribution is approximately $56 per month for employee-only coverage, up to approximately $162 per month for employee plus family coverage. Coverage opt-out for dependents is only available if spouse/domestic partner is contributing to an HSA-qualifying plan or is covered under Medicare.
Life/AD&D
City-paid $75,000 employee life insurance policy. (Employer-paid premium exceeding the life insurance value of $50,000 is taxable.)
Long-Term Disability
Benefit is 66 2/3% of employee’s monthly salary after a 90-day waiting period. Premium fully paid by the City.
Supplemental (Employee paid)
Optional insurance plans available: (Coverage may not be guaranteed and may require underwriting approval.)
- Short-term Disability – Coverage is guaranteed for new employees. Cost of purchased coverage varies. A 7-day waiting period with a 90-day maximum benefit.
- Additional term life insurance – Available coverage for employee, spouse, and eligible dependents.
- Accident, Cancer, Hospital, Intensive Care, and Specific Event Insurance – Available coverage for employee, spouse, and eligible dependents.
Retirement
PERS / OPSRP
Participation in the Oregon Public Employee Retirement System. City pays employer contribution as well as employee’s 6.0% IAP contribution.
Deferred Compensation
City pays one-half of one percent (0.5%) of employee’s regular base pay into a 457 pre-tax deferred compensation plan with employee-selected provider (ICMA-RC or Nationwide Retirement Solutions) with no match required. Employee may also make contributions to a 457 pre-tax or Roth deferred compensation plan.
Other Benefits
Education Reimbursement
Reimbursement of 75% of tuition and book fees for successful completion of pre-approved, job-related college courses or courses within an institutional approved degree program.
Employee Assistance Program
Access to the City’s confidential Employee Assistance Programs (EAP) for employees and eligible dependents. Coverage includes 8 counseling sessions per covered individual per calendar year at no cost to employees plus additional services including financial and legal advice, coaching, crisis support, and more.
Flexible Spending Plan (125)
Deferral plan for dependent care, eligible insurance premiums, and out-of- pocket medical expenses paid on pretax basis. Employee must enroll annually each benefit (calendar) year.
Voluntary Employee Benefits Association (VEBA Trust)
Annual employer-paid contribution to an HRA VEBA account when enrolled in City’s health insurance plan. Annual City contribution of $1,000 for employee-only coverage or $2,000 for employee plus dependent(s) coverage. Funds can be used for out-of-pocket healthcare expenses while employed or saved for healthcare expenses in retirement, with funds growing tax-free.
Paid Family Medical Leave
Oregon Paid Family Medical Leave coverage provided through the City’s third-party administrator.
Longevity Incentive
Employees receive additional longevity pay follows:
| Years of Continuous Service | Longevity Pay/Leave* |
|---|---|
| 120 months (10 years) | 2% |
| 168 months (14 years) | 5% |
| 228 months (19 years) | 8% |
| 264 months (22 years) | One-time award of 40 hours of longevity leave |
| 324 months (27 years) | 10% |
*Longevity pay is calculated off the employee’s regular base pay, and rates listed are not cumulative.
This document provides a high-level summary of City benefits. Refer to applicable City policies and the collective bargaining agreement for additional details. All benefits and contributions listed in this summary apply to full-time employees and are subject to change. Part-time employee benefits are prorated based on the employee’s regularly scheduled FTE or, in some instances, may not apply. Please contact Human Resources at
